Paul Gulacy - Original Cover Art for Whodunnit? #2 (Eclipse, 1986). This eerie Paul Gulacy cover spotlights a man in a torn shirt, fighting for his life, as he is tormented by three demonic, animal men. Shades of Hieronymus Bosch! Paul Gulacy's talent for photo-realistic rendering heightens the absolute feeling of menace. The overall art paper measures 13" x 20", with an image area of 11.75" x 18". The art is in outstanding shape. The cover retains its original title-logo and type stats. Signed "Gulacy '86" in the lower right.
